Tory leader Kemi Badenoch has called for the Dartmoor ponies to be saved from a mass cull at the hands of civil servants. Is it silly season already?
Unaccountable quango Natural England says that livestock grazing on the moor have to be cut by 75% to protect ‘biodiversity.’ Farmers will not be culling their own livestock…
The Dartmoor ponies – semi-wild today – have been present in the area since 3500 BC until coming against Natural England. Nine in ten of them would have to be culled according to the quango’s demands. The ponies also provide crucial grazing and combat invasive species of flora…
Natural England says it’s up to the landowners to carry out its arbitrary demands. Badenoch said this morning:
“This is total madness from another unaccountable quango. The government must overrule Natural England and stop it immediately.
Keir Starmer is on his way to making his last acts in office the shameful underfunding of our military and the mass slaughter of Dartmoor ponies.”
